Jar Candle Basics
Jar candles are simple and popular decorative items. They offer light and fragrance in a safe container. People use them for relaxation, decoration, and fresh scents.
These candles come in glass jars that protect the flame and wax. The jar also helps the candle burn evenly and longer. Understanding jar candle basics helps you choose the right one for your needs.
Types Of Jar Candles
There are many types of jar candles. Some have strong scents, while others are unscented. You can find soy, beeswax, paraffin, and gel candles in jars. Each type has a different burn time and smell. Some jars are small for travel or gifts. Others are large for longer use.
Common Ingredients
Jar candles mostly contain wax and a wick. Wax can be natural like soy or beeswax. Paraffin wax is a common, cheaper option. The wick is usually cotton or wood. Scents come from essential oils or fragrance oils. Some candles also have color added for decoration.

How To Use Jar Candles Safely
Using jar candles safely is important to enjoy their warm light without risk. Proper care helps prevent accidents and keeps your home safe. Follow simple safety tips for the best experience.
Placement Tips
Place jar candles on a flat, stable surface. Keep them away from curtains, papers, and other flammable items. Avoid placing candles near fans or vents. Keep candles out of reach of children and pets. Use heat-resistant holders or trays to catch wax drips.
Burning Guidelines
Trim the wick to about 1/4 inch before lighting. This keeps the flame small and steady. Do not burn a candle for more than four hours at once. Always extinguish candles before leaving a room. Avoid moving a burning candle to prevent spills and fires.
Candle Care And Maintenance
Candle care and maintenance help your jar candle last longer and burn safely. Simple steps can improve the candle’s life and keep its scent fresh. Taking care of your candle also prevents problems like smoke or uneven burning.
Extending Burn Time
Trim the wick before each use to about 1/4 inch. This stops the flame from getting too big. Burn the candle for at least 2 hours at a time. This helps the wax melt evenly and avoids tunneling. Avoid burning the candle near drafts or fans. This keeps the flame steady and safe.
Cleaning And Storage
Let the candle cool completely before cleaning. Remove any debris from the wax surface. Store candles in a cool, dry place away from sunlight. Keep the lid on to protect the scent. Clean the jar with warm water and mild soap. Avoid harsh chemicals that can damage the jar or wax.

Essential Supplies
- Wax – soy or paraffin work well
- Wicks – cotton or wood types
- Glass jars – clean and dry
- Fragrance oils – your favorite scents
- Double boiler – for melting wax
- Thermometer – to check wax temperature
- Stirring spoon or stick
- Glue dots or wick holders
Step-by-step Process
- Prepare your workspace. Cover surfaces to catch spills.
- Attach the wick to the jar bottom using glue dots.
- Melt the wax slowly in the double boiler.
- Check the wax temperature with the thermometer.
- Add fragrance oils when the wax is warm but not hot.
- Pour the wax into the jar carefully.
- Hold the wick straight until the wax sets.
- Let the candle cool completely before trimming the wick.

Frequently Asked Questions
What Is A Jar Candle Used For?
A jar candle provides ambient lighting and a pleasant scent. It is commonly used for home décor, relaxation, and aromatherapy.
How Long Do Jar Candles Typically Burn?
Jar candles usually burn between 30 to 60 hours, depending on size and wax type. Always follow manufacturer guidelines for best use.
What Materials Are Jar Candles Made From?
Jar candles are made from wax, a wick, and a glass container. Common wax types include soy, paraffin, and beeswax.
Are Jar Candles Safer Than Other Candles?
Yes, jar candles are safer because the glass container contains melted wax and flame. This reduces fire hazards and wax spills.
